1. Importance of Comprehensive Patient Assessment

Before any dental implant procedure, a thorough patient assessment is crucial. Dentists must evaluate the patients medical history, including any existing health conditions that might affect the surgery. Conditions like diabetes, cardiovascular disease, or autoimmune disorders can complicate the healing process. Understanding these factors can help the dentist tailor the procedure to the patient’s specific needs.
Diagnostic imaging plays a vital role in the assessment phase. Imaging technologies such as X-rays, CT scans, or 3D imaging can provide detailed information about the bone structure and density. This information is crucial for determining whether there is sufficient bone to support the implant. A comprehensive assessment ensures that the selected treatment plan is appropriate and safe for the patient.
Moreover, psychological readiness is an often-overlooked aspect of patient evaluation. Understanding the patients expectations, fears, and anxiety levels can help the dental team prepare adequately and provide the necessary support. Clear communication about the procedure and what to expect can alleviate apprehensions and foster a collaborative relationship with the patient.
2. Adhering to Sterile Surgical Techniques
One of the paramount considerations during dental implant procedures is the maintenance of a sterile environment. Infection control begins with the surgical area, requiring strict adherence to protocols for sterilization of tools and equipment. Dental professionals must use single-use instruments whenever possible and ensure that all reusable tools are appropriately sterilized.
Additionally, the surgical team should employ aseptic techniques throughout the procedure. This includes proper hand hygiene, the use of gloves, masks, and gowns. Minimizing contamination risks is essential to reduce the chances of post-operative infections, which can lead to complications and negatively impact healing.
The choice of implant material also cannot be overlooked in the context of safety. Using high-quality, biocompatible materials that have been rigorously tested can reduce complications during healing. Ensuring that the materials meet international safety standards can significantly boost success rates and patient satisfaction.
3. Effective Post-Operative Care Strategies
Post-operative care is critical for patient recovery following dental implant surgery. Immediately after the procedure, patients should receive clear instructions regarding care. This includes guidelines related to diet, medication management, and oral hygiene practices to prevent complications.
Pain management is another vital aspect of post-operative care. Providers should discuss pain medication options with patients and suggest appropriate dosages to manage discomfort effectively. Being proactive in pain management can improve the overall patient experience and encourage adherence to post-operative guidelines.
Follow-up appointments are essential for monitoring the healing process. Regular check-ups allow dental professionals to assess the implant site for any signs of infection or complications. Establishing a proactive follow-up schedule can significantly enhance patient outcomes and ensure any issues are addressed promptly.
4. Managing Potential Complications Early
Despite careful planning and execution, complications can still arise during or after dental implant procedures. Common issues include infection, implant failure, or nerve damage. Awareness of these potential complications is critical for dental professionals to manage them effectively.
Regular training and education on the latest advancements in dental surgery and implant technology can empower practitioners to mitigate risks and respond quickly if complications arise. Implementing a protocol for managing complications can enhance the teams preparedness and response time during emergencies.
Lastly, fostering open communication with patients is crucial in managing any complications. Patient education about what signs or symptoms to watch for post-surgery empowers them to seek assistance promptly if complications develop. Educated patients are more likely to engage with their care, thus improving overall outcomes.
